WikiDer > Инспектор Intel
Разработчики) | Продукты Intel для разработчиков |
---|---|
Стабильный выпуск | Обновление 3 2020 г. / 20 октября 2020 г.[1] |
Операционная система | Windows и Linux |
Тип | [Отладчик памяти] и отладчик потоков |
Лицензия | Проприетарное, бесплатное ПО[2] |
Интернет сайт | программного обеспечения |
Intel Инспектор (преемник Intel Thread Checker) - это инструмент для проверки и отладки памяти и потоков для повышения надежности, безопасности и точности C/C ++ и приложения Fortran.
- Надежность: обнаружение взаимоблокировок и ошибок памяти, вызывающих зависания и сбои
- Безопасность: Найдите уязвимости памяти и потоковой передачи, используемые хакерами
- Точность: выявление повреждений памяти и условий гонки для устранения ошибочных результатов.
Проверка памяти включает утечки памяти, висячие указатели, неинициализированные переменные, использование недопустимых ссылок на память, несовпадение памяти, выделение и освобождение, проверка памяти стека и трассировка стека с контролируемой глубиной трассировки стека
Проверка потоков включает условия гонки, тупиковые ситуации, анализ стека вызовов с настраиваемой глубиной, руководство по диагностике, встроенные знания Заправка строительных блоков (TBB), OpenMPи потоки POSIX или Win32.
Доступен как часть Intel Parallel Studio.
Ограничения
- Он не поддерживает среду выполнения GNU OpenMP и может сообщать о ложных срабатываниях для кодов OpenMP, скомпилированных GCC.
Смотрите также
- Intel Parallel Studio XE
- Советник Intel - инструмент оптимизации векторизации и прототипирования потоков
- Усилитель Intel VTune - профилировщик производительности
- Intel Библиотека ускорения аналитики данных (DAAL)
- Intel Интегрированные примитивы производительности (IPP)
- Intel Математическая библиотека ядра (MKL)
- Intel Заправка строительных блоков (TBB)
- Зона разработчиков Intel (Intel DZ; поддержка и обсуждение)
- Отладчик памяти
- Утечка памяти